#d07725 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d07725 is composed of 81.6% red, 46.7%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.8% magenta, 82.2%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 28.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 48%. #d07725 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ffee4a with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d07725 color description : Strong orange.

#d07725 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d07725 has RGB values of R:208, G:119,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.82,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13661989.

Hex triplet d07725 #d07725
RGB Decimal 208, 119, 37 rgb(208,119,37)
RGB Percent 81.6, 46.7, 14.5 rgb(81.6%,46.7%,14.5%)
CMYK 0, 43, 82, 18
HSL 28.8°, 69.8, 48 hsl(28.8,69.8%,48%)
HSV (or HSB) 28.8°, 82.2, 81.6
Web Safe cc6633 #cc6633
CIE-LAB 58.733, 29.1, 56.396
XYZ 32.944, 26.74, 5.177
xyY 0.508, 0.412, 26.74
CIE-LCH 58.733, 63.461, 62.707
CIE-LUV 58.733, 72.746, 51.133
Hunter-Lab 51.711, 23.227, 30.262
Binary 11010000, 01110111, 00100101

Shades and Tints of #d07725

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080501 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d07725

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7a7a is the less saturated color, while #ec7609 is the most saturated one.
